What Are No Chalk Gymnastic Grips?
No Chalk rubber gymnastic grips are high-adhesion CrossFit hand grips engineered to generate friction without magnesium carbonate (chalk). They use a rubber-based polymer surface to create direct traction against the bar.
These grips are designed for athletes training in chalk-restricted or chalk-free facilities who require consistent grip during high-volume pulling.
Ideal for:
-
Commercial gyms with no-chalk policies
-
Boutique training facilities
-
Shared training environments
-
Travel training
Athletes who prefer a direct, adhesive feel on the bar typically choose rubber-based grips over glide-based leather systems.

No Chalk vs Leather Gymnastic Grips
Rubber grips and leather grips function differently.
No Chalk Rubber Grips
-
Do not require chalk
-
Generate friction through surface adhesion
-
Provide direct bar contact
-
Typically experience higher wear due to increased friction
Leather or Microfiber Grips
-
Require chalk for optimal performance
-
Create friction through chalk activation
-
Allow controlled glide on the bar
-
Generally offer longer wear life
Rubber grips trade longevity for chalk independence and immediate traction.
Materials & Construction
No Chalk grips are constructed using:
-
High-adhesion rubber polymer compound (primary contact surface)
-
Reinforced nylon or Kevlar fiber layer embedded within the rubber matrix
-
Textured or smooth outer finishes depending on model
Performance may vary depending on bar surface:
-
Powder-coated bars
-
Bare steel bars
-
Stainless steel bars
-
Cerakote-coated bars
Higher friction surfaces may accelerate grip wear. This is expected due to increased surface adhesion.

Not Recommended For
-
Gymnastic rings
Due to high surface adhesion, rubber grips may lock onto rings and prevent natural rotation. This can increase internal hand friction and reduce protective function.
Cleaning & Care
To maintain consistent grip performance:
-
Hand wash only
-
Use mild soap and water
-
Do not machine wash
-
Air dry flat
-
Avoid high heat exposure
Periodic cleaning of the rubber surface helps maintain optimal traction by removing sweat and residue buildup.
